Transaction 786226ae5ef49239dec5ee00f76f322a05cf400d0598a7f91e79e2e181bb658b
1 Input
1 Output
-
786226ae5ef49239dec5ee00f76f322a05cf400d0598a7f91e79e2e181bb658b:0
- value
- 3352683
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e0cc06c97ebccfa3a254c4ee20435e336b41d5c9 OP_EQUAL
- address
- 3NBdhXNANR36c3KqyfHN6og18Pi2pSW6rd